In Westport, professional cabinet installation typically ranges from $2,000 to $8,000+ for a standard kitchen, with high-end projects often exceeding $15,000. Costs are influenced by local labor rates, the complexity of the design, and the grade of cabinetry (semi-custom/custom from local showrooms are common). We recommend budgeting an additional 10-15% for unforeseen issues common in older Westport homes, like uneven plaster walls or outdated plumbing/electrical discovered during installation.
Westport's proximity to Long Island Sound means higher humidity, especially in summer, which can cause wood to expand and contract. We strongly recommend using moisture-resistant materials like marine-grade plywood for boxes and specifying finishes with excellent humidity tolerance. Proper installation must include climate control in the home during the process and adequate sealing to prevent future warping or joint separation, which is a common issue in our region if not addressed.
For a straightforward cabinet replacement, a permit is usually not required. However, if your project involves altering the kitchen's footprint, moving plumbing or electrical, or modifying load-bearing walls, a permit from the Westport Building Department will be necessary. The installation itself for a standard kitchen typically takes 2-4 days, but the entire process from measurement to final hardware adjustment can take 4-8 weeks, accounting for fabrication and careful scheduling around local contractor availability.
Prioritize local installers with extensive experience in Fairfield County's older, high-value homes. Verify they are fully insured and licensed (Home Improvement Contractor registration in CT is crucial). Ask for references in Westport or neighboring towns to see their work firsthand and ensure they understand local aesthetic preferences and the specific challenges of working in historic or luxury properties, which are prevalent here.
Yes, the best times for installation are late spring and early fall to avoid the peak summer humidity and the holiday season. Many Westport homeowners schedule renovations for the period between January and March, but this requires coordinating with your installer well in advance. Be mindful that severe winter weather can occasionally delay deliveries, and summer vacation schedules can impact crew availability, so firm up timelines in your contract.
